  • The fairy tale was previously adapted as the libretto of the opera Le Coq d'Or or Coq D'Or.
  • Willy Pogány "designed the setting" [sets?] for its Metropolitan Opera House production 20 years ago. --NYT
  • "Pogany has illustrated it in colors bright as those we remember from the old days of the Moscow Art Theater, and with much the same decor, only of course with the robust and violent exaggeration of the fairy tale." 12 large color plates, b/w illustrations every other page --NYHT
